Job Summary

The Medical Education Professional Services Coordinator is responsible for the seamless execution and logistical management of educational programs, surgical training labs, and medical education events for healthcare professionals (HCPs). This role ensures that all training events, whether hands-on bioskills labs, virtual webinars, meetings or large-scale symposia are executed flawlessly, on time, and in strict compliance with medical device industry regulations (e.g., AdvaMed Code, Sunshine Act).
